WebNov 22, 2024 · The volume of a cylinder is the radius squared times pi times the thickness, which means one dime takes up approximately 0.0207 cubic inch of space. A 2 Liter bottle is 122.0475 cubic inches. Doing some simple division, we can determine that a 2 Liter bottle could theoretically contain 5893 dimes or roughly $589.30.
